#7b4be4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7b4be4 is composed of 48.2% red, 29.4%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.1% cyan, 67.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 258.8 degrees, a saturation of 73.9% and a lightness of 59.4%. #7b4be4 color hex could be obtained by blending #f696ff with #0000c9.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

Shades and Tints of #7b4be4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030108 is the darkest color, while #f8f6fe is the lightest one.
